WebDec 30, 2024 · Examples are a cut, scrape, bruise or swelling. It is common for children to fall and hit their head while growing up. This is especially common when a child is learning to walk. Big lumps (bruises) can occur with minor injuries. This is because there is a large blood supply to the scalp. For the same reason, small cuts on the head may bleed a lot. WebDec 30, 2024 · Symptoms of Impetigo. Sores smaller than 1 inch (2.5 cm) Often covered by a soft, yellow-brown scab or crust. Scabs may drain pus or yellow fluid off and on. Starts as small red bumps. These change quickly to cloudy blisters or pimples. Then, they become open sores which drain fluid or pus. Sores increase in size.
